 Since the launch of the Herschel Space Observatory, our understanding about the photo-dissociation 
 regions (PDR) has taken a step forward. In the bandwidth of the Fourier Transform Spectrometer (FTS) 
 of the Spectral and Photometric Imaging REceiver (SPIRE) on board Herschel, ten CO rotational transitions, 
 including J=4-3 to J=13-12, and three fine structure lines, including [CI] 609, [CI] 370, and [NII] 250 micron, 
 are covered. In this talk, I present our findings from the FTS observations at the nuclear region of M83, 
 based on the spatially resolved physical parameters derived from the CO spectral line energy distribution 
 (SLED) map and the comparisons with the dust properties and star-formation tracers. I will discuss 
 (1) the potential of using [NII] 250 and [CI] 370 micron as star-formation tracers; (2) the reliability of 
 tracing molecular gas with CO; (3) the excitation mechanisms of warm CO; (4) the possibility of studying 
 stellar feedback by tracing the thermal pressure of molecular gas in the nuclear region of M83.
Comprehensive and systematic studies of the molecular content of galaxies during the epochs that are associated with the peak (z~1-2), and subsequent winding down (z<1) of star formation in the Universe are enabling us to illustrate the important role that cold gas, , the fuel for star formation, has played in the assembly of galaxies across cosmic time.  Surveys, including COLDGASS and PHIBSS1&2,  already provide robust molecular gas detections in hundreds of normal, star forming galaxies, from redshifts 0-2.5.  In this talk, we focus on results from PHIBSS, comprising two IRAM Large Programs, where we are we have are mapping the CO J=3-2 or J-2-1 line emission in ~200 such galaxies from z=0.5-2.5; we find that galaxies at these epochs are very gas rich, relative to their star-forming counterparts in the local Universe.  We discuss scaling relations for massive star forming galaxies that we derive from these data, and the impact of all of these new observations on our understanding of galaxy evolution in the early Universe.

 Since the recognition of Chile as an Astronomical paradise about 50 years ago, 
 Chilean Astronomy has grown inflactionary to the proportion of being today 
 one of the most productive areas of science in Chile, represented by a well developed 
 community at the level of the most developed countries. Today we are facing 
 a second phase in this growth with a program aimed at the development in Chile 
 of instrumentation for astronomy. This task is being especially challenging 
 because of the limiting boundary conditions of a developing country. 
 In this talk I will present the efforts carried out in this direction at the Center of 
 Astro Engineering UC, the first scientific results obtained with astronomical instruments 
 made in Chile and the exciting challenges that we are preparing for the future.

  銀河が周辺銀河と衝突・合体しながら成長するの
 にあわせ、銀河中心の巨大ブラックホールも同様に
 合体成長してきたと考えられています。この過程の
 検証の一環として、我々は、大規模数値シミュレー
 ションと放射スペクトルの理論計算を基に、アンド
 ロメダ銀河に衝突した衛星銀河の元中心ブラックホ
 ールを探査する研究を行ってきました(Miki et al.
 2014; Kawaguchi et al. 2014)。
  衛星銀河の大部分は、潮汐力により散り散りにな
 りアンドロメダストリームなどを形成している一方、
 潮汐破壊を耐えて生き残った衛星銀河中心部は、中
 心に大質量ブラックホールを含む星団として、現在、
 アンドロメダ銀河円盤の外縁部に居ると考えられま
 す。我々の計算結果は、漂う巨大ブラックホールへ
 の星間ガスの降着流は電波波長域で、星団は近赤外
 線・可視光で検出できる事を示唆しています。
  近年の電波・可視光・X線観測結果が示す、このよ
 うな漂う巨大ブラックホールが原因と考えられる天
 体例3種の紹介も行います。
